From Roadside Diagnosis to Repair or Towing
Roadside service starts with your exact location, travel direction, vehicle type, trailer, load, warning lights, symptoms, and location on the road. The dispatcher selects the response unit depending on the likely cause, required tools, tire size, parts, exposure to traffic, and if towing might be needed. The technician confirms the complaint, checks the system, and attempts a restart or a temporary fix. The technician must use their discretion with battery, tire, fuel, air, braking, cooling, and electrical, as each has different safety concerns. A roadside repair must only be performed if the location becomes safe and the vehicle can be returned to service without driving it in an unsafe condition. If the fault requires a lift, shop diagnostics, major parts, extended labor, or a safer environment, towing is arranged. The technician describes what was found, what was repaired, and what must be checked the next route again. We stay precise. You get no fluff before, during, or after the work.


How to Tell if a Roadside Fix is Safe vs Emergency Towing Needed?
Roadside assistance can be of service in safe conditions. Some common fixes that can be addressed roadside include minor Mechanical fixes and small electrical or air-line issues. Unfortunately, roadside fixes are not applicable for severe brake or steering problems, major leaks, collision issues, locked wheels, or positioned in a dangerous way on the roadway. Ignoring warning lights or continuing to drive on issues that have temporarily resolved may be dangerous. Even if warning lights are no longer on, issues can still persist with the battery, charging system, and cooling system, as well as problems with the wheels, brakes, air, and engine. It is important to document the warning code and the symptoms, and roadside interventions on the unit to assist the shop in diagnosing the concern.
